PIXMA MX300 installation in Windows 8.1 64 bit, USB 3.0 failed - blank pages, incomplete pages

 I just bought a Lenovo ThinkPad with Win 8.1 64bit and I downloaded from Canon the driver for the PIXMA MX300. My USB ports are all 3.0, and sometime I get error that Pixma wants a 2.0 but that is not necessarily the problem. The computer recognizes the printer and will start to print. However, first several blank pages will eject without any attempt to print, then the printer will start to print, but will only  do a few lines before stopping and ejecting the paper, unfinished. It will repeat this endlessly if not aborted. The particular example is a reasonably small graphic in Windows Paint. Here, within Print, Page setup, print options, one can reduce spool size, but that does not fix the problem.
Re: the USB's  I have tried both 3.0 direct and via a hub I bought quite some time ago. The USB cable is quite long.  
Windows says it is on USB support and that the printer is working properly, but it is not. Please help. It is a good machine.

Ok, I discovered that it was the 16+ foot USB cable. It was elsewhere on this forum. At present, the MX300 is printing fine from a 3.0 USB port. Whether it will survive a cheap hub, I don't know yet.

  • Photoshop 7 (& other old Adobe programs) installation in Windows 7 Pro 64 bit

    Recently I purchased a new computer running Windows 7 Pro (64 bit) with 2 TB hard drive and 16 GB memory and faced the task of trying to install Photoshop 7, Illustrator 8, Acrobat 8 Pro, and Dreamweaver CS3 that I had used very satisfactorily on my old Windows XP SP 3, 2GB memory computer with less than 1 TB hard drive. I now have all of these running successfully on my new computer and thought I would share here my experience gleaned from a number of other forums after many hours. I had the most problem with Photoshop 7 which I will describe last. In all cases I had the original genuine installation disks. These are generally needed except for Illustrator 8.
    Dreamweaver CS3 -- This installed easily in the Program Files (x86) folder & does not seem to require running in XP compatibility mode
    Acrobat 8 Pro -- Same as Dreamweaver CS3
    Illustrator 8 -- The installation disk would not work for Windows 7 Pro 64 bit. A solution I found in a Microsoft forum is simply to copy the Illustrator folder and contents into the ProgramData folder on the new computer along with the following dll files in the C\Windows folder of the old computer: icccodes.dll, kpcp32.dll, kpsys32.dll, pcdlib32.dll, pfpick.dll, sprof32.dll  These go right into the Illustrator folder. This program needs to be run using XP compatibility mode (after copying preceding files go to Control Panel --> Programs --> Programs and Features --> Run programs made for previous versions of Windows -- follow directions there). It might be possible to copy into the Program Files (x86) folder too, but the ProgramData folder works. I have not actually used Illustrator after doing this, but since it started ok, I presume that there will be no problems.
    Photoshop 7 -- My Photoshop 7 was an upgrade from Photoshop 5. The PS 5 installation disk would not run on Windows 7 & when I tried the PS 7 upgrade disk (autorun) I got the message that it could not find a previous version of PS & then shut down the installation. I tried the method used for Illustrator 8 above (suggested on yet another forum with an additional dll identified in another Windows folder), but I got the message "Could not complete your request because of missing or invalid personalization information". This evidently had to do with missing authentication serial code number in the registry. I found some discussion of this in forums but no workable fix in my case which involved an upgrade. Then I discovered inormation in another forum which explained that installation with the disks could be done by inserting the upgrade disk and running it from the setup.exe file instead of autorun. When you do this you are presented with the option of proving your previous version of PS by simply inserting the earlier version PS disk at this pint of the process. After doing this the installation with the upgrade disk proceeds fine. The PS 7 program can be installed in the Adobe folder within the Program Files (x86) folder. However, after doing this and trying to start PS 7 you get the following error (if your hard drive is 1 TB or greater in capacity): "Could not inititialize Photoshop because the scratch disk are full" After much reading I learned that this occurs because PS 7 apparently cannot recognize partitions (volumes) 1 TB or greater. What you need to do is set up an additional partition (volume) on your hard drive. This is easy to do. Go to Windows Help, search on "create partition", choose "Create and format a hard disk partition", and follow the directions. I decided to make a 50 GB partion I named "scratch". The system will assign a drive letter to it. To use the new partion to allow PS 7 to start you need to start PS 7 and immediately press the ALT and CTRL keys together. This will bring up a window where you tell PS 7 which drives to use for its scratch disk. You need to select the newly-created scratch disk(partition) in the first choice and leave the other choices as "None". After doing this you have one last issue. When you try to save any file in PS 7 you cannot save it directly anywhee on the C drive since that drive is 1 TB or greater. What I do is save it to the scratch drive and then later move it from there to where I want it on my C drive. I have seen it suggested to install the PS 7 program itself on the newly-created scratch drive, but I don't know if this would allow saving files to the C drive. When installed the way I have described it does not seem to require operating in the XP compatibility mode.
    Hope this helps those of you who prefer working with the programs they are used to on Windows 7 Pro 64 bit.

  • Help! Installation of Windows 7 Pro 64-bit fails...

    I am trying to install Windows 7 Pro 64-bit on my new video system:
    - I boot the PC with the install CD inserted
    - I get
        . the installation screen
        . accept licence agreement
        . select on which disk I want to install windows
        . the copy to disk finishes
        . the next step is to reboot my system so that windows continues the install from disk.
       . however after the reboot, just after the systems POST, I just get a black screen and nothing happens.
    I already removed all other disks and removed the raid card :
       So only the...
           - motherboard Asus P6T SE
           - CPU : Intel quad core 950 3.2Mhz
           - Corsair 12 GB
           - single WD 160GB disk ( for windows )
           - LG DVD player
           - Corsair PSU
           - ps2 keyboard
           - ps2 mouse
      ... remains attached
    What is also strange is that there is no F6 during the install of Windows XP. Previously you could press F6 for additional drivers.
    Now you can not.  I tried to press F6 a couple of times but no additional options came on the screen.
    I also allready preformated the disk : single partition and NTFS preformated with default 4kb cluster size.
    Anybody an idea?

    Thanks... above helped... when searching on that forum I found someting about changing SATA from IDE to AHCI.
    So in the bios I changed ...
       > Storage Configuration > Change Configure SATA as IDE
    ... to ...
    > Storage Configuration > Change Configure SATA as RAID
    ... and now it seems to work.
    I used RAID instead of simple AHCI because I want to use raid0 (striping) for my paging disks.
    So I will have a single disk for W7 Pro and use 2 disks for paging and cache.
    My other 6 disks will later be used in raid3 on an areca controller.

  • Solved Crackling Problem in Windows 7 (SB 24-bit USB External, HP Pavilion dv6 1124-ca laptop).

    I'm one of many users who has had problems with the sound crackling problem with their sound card after upgrading to Windows 7.
    I was previously on Windows Vista running 5. with 24-bit, 96000Hz sample rate Studio Quality with no problems at all. When I upgraded to Windows 7 RC, Windows was able to automatically find a driver for my external USB sound card, but when playing music, I always got a constant crackling sound coming from the speakers while trying to put the card in anything above 2. or and when putting it in 24-bit 96000Hz, the crackling only got worse. Installing the Beta drivers on the Creative site didn't work either... still had the crackling. I searched around for the past several months for solutions to no avail.
    Then today, I was surfing the HP website (I have a HP Pavilion dv6 24-ca laptop) to see if they had added Windows 7 drivers to their support site and they did... and so I started downloading all available Windows 7 drivers for my specific laptop. When I first installed Windows 7 RC, it had installed it's own drivers for everything (on-board sound etc.). After replacing the Windows 7 installed "High Definition Audio Device" drivers with the HP supplied "IDT High Definition Audio CODEC" drivers... I'm not sure if the on board sound driver has anything at all to do with the crackling on the Soundblaster but I replaced the drivers anyway. I also installed another driver called "AMD USB Filter" that was supplied by the HP website for Windows 7 which is another driver that I thought might help with the problem. Other drivers installed were "ENE CIR Reciever Driver" and "Realtek Card Reader Driver" but those have nothing to do with the sound card.
    After installing the drivers from the HP website, I no longer get the crackling from the speakers when playing in 5.. I am also now able to select 24-bit 96000Hz sample rate without crackling as well I am very happy to have finally solved the problem. So to anyone having similar problems, I suggest you check out your manufacturers website to see if they have any drivers available for you... I have a feeling the AMD USB Filter is what solved the problem... but who knows.
